MPP 架构简介
MPP(Massively Parallel Processing)是一种大规模并行处理架构,它可以在多个处理器之间并行处理数据,以实现高性能计算。MPP 架构通常用于大型数据仓库和数据分析系统,以处理大量数据和提供实时分析结果。
名词概念
MPP 架构是一种计算架构,它通过在多个处理器之间并行处理数据来实现高性能计算。MPP 架构通常用于大型数据仓库和数据分析系统,以处理大量数据和提供实时分析结果。
分类
MPP 架构可以分为以下几类:
- 共享内存 MPP:所有处理器共享同一个内存空间,通过高速互联网络进行通信。
- 分布式内存 MPP:每个处理器都有自己的内存空间,通过互联网络进行通信。
- 混合内存 MPP:共享内存和分布式内存的混合使用。
优势
MPP 架构具有以下优势:
- 高性能:MPP 架构可以在多个处理器之间并行处理数据,实现高性能计算。
- 可扩展性:MPP 架构可以通过添加更多的处理器来扩展计算能力。
- 容错性:MPP 架构可以通过多个处理器协同工作来提高容错性。
应用场景
MPP 架构适用于以下应用场景:
- 大型数据仓库:MPP 架构可以处理大量数据,并提供高性能查询和分析功能。
- 数据分析:MPP 架构可以用于数据分析,以提供实时分析结果和洞察力。
- 高性能计算:MPP 架构可以用于高性能计算,以实现复杂的数值计算和模拟。
推荐的腾讯云相关产品
腾讯云提供以下相关产品:
- 腾讯云 CVM:腾讯云 CVM 是一种虚拟机服务,可以通过购买多个 CVM 实例来构建 MPP 架构。
- 腾讯云 TKE:腾讯云 TKE 是一种容器服务,可以通过部署多个容器来构建 MPP 架构。
- 腾讯云 CLS:腾讯云 CLS 是一种日志服务,可以用于处理和分析大量日志数据。
请注意,腾讯云不提供 MPP 架构本身,但是可以通过组合多个产品来构建 MPP 架构。